PPL Group, Capital Recovery Group (CRG), and Rabin Announce Major Auction of Former Ponderay Paper Mill in Usk, WA
PPL Group, Capital Recovery Group (CRG), and Rabin Announce Major Auction of Former Ponderay Paper Mill in Usk, WA

A unique opportunity to acquire high-capacity paper manufacturing equipment and mill support assets is set to unfold as three leading industrial asset management firms--PPL Group, CRG, and Rabin Worldwide--join forces to conduct a public auction of the former Ponderay Newsprint Mill located in Usk, Washington. The auction will be held online and the two-day sale will be on July 22nd and July 23rd. Pre-Auction offers are encouraged.

Stora Enso and Metsähallitus Parks & Wildlife Finland sign Euro 1.1 million cooperation agreement
Stora Enso and Metsähallitus Parks & Wildlife Finland sign Euro 1.1 million cooperation agreement

Stora Enso and Metsähallitus Parks & Wildlife Finland announced the start of a cooperation to protect the highly endangered freshwater pearl mussel in Finland. During the almost six-year contract period, mussel habitats will be mapped, inventoried and restored, watercourses will be restored and managed, and information system data will be improved. Stora Enso will finance the programme with Euro 1.1 million by the end of 2030.
